The successful applicant will be responsible for planning and delivering engaging Business Studies lessons across Key Stages 3 and 4 (and potentially KS5), ensuring that all students are motivated and challenged to achieve their full potential. You will assess and monitor pupil progress, differentiate lessons to meet a range of abilities including those with special educational needs, and contribute to the development of schemes of work. As part of your role, you will foster an inclusive classroom environment, manage behaviour effectively in line with school policies, and actively participate in departmental meetings and wider school initiatives. You will also be expected to maintain accurate records of student performance and provide constructive feedback to support academic development.
Ideal Candidate
We are looking for a reliable and enthusiastic teacher with a genuine passion for Business Studies and education. The ideal candidate will hold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or have significant experience teaching Business Studies within a secondary school setting. Applications are welcome from both experienced teachers and confident subject specialists with relevant curriculum knowledge. A minimum qualification of GCSE grade 4/C in English and Maths is essential. You should be available to work Monday to Friday, 8:30am–3:30pm, during term time and committed to a long-term placement. Strong classroom management skills, excellent communication, and the ability to adapt teaching strategies to support students with varying learning needs, including SEN, are highly desirable. Due to the location, access to your own transport is highly beneficial.

Things are changing within education supply — and it’s creating new opportunities for staff working with 4myschools.
From September, most schools will use approved agencies through the Government Commercial Agency (GCA) framework.
